August 2024 Election Calendar: US Politics Dominates Month

The August 2024 election calendar is quiet for most of the world, but the American election will kick into high gear.

Though the United States will not elect its president and Congress until November, the campaign is in full swing. It will headline an otherwise sleepy month on the electoral calendar.

August 2024 Election Calendar: US President

Beginning on August 19, the Democratic Party will hold its quadrennial convention in Chicago. It is all but certain that they will nominate Kamala Harris, the sitting vice president, as its candidate for president. This will be the second time in history that a female will be a major party nominee in the United States.

Harris will accept her nomination on Thursday, August 22 in an address to the Democratic National Convention delegates.

This looks like a very, very different convention than many would have imagined in June. At that point, President Joe Biden was still a candidate, and following his debate performance, his odds of re-election sunk. On July 21, he withdrew and endorsed Kamala Harris, and she is set to take up her mantle as the party’s new leader. One can expect, however, that the DNC will pay tribute to Biden and give him a prime-time speech.

August 2024 Election Calendar: US Mayoral Elections

Two major cities will elect mayors in August: Miami, Florida and Tulsa, Oklahoma. Miami’s poll will take place on August 20, while Tulsa elects their mayor a week later on August 27.

Miami-Dade County elects a county-wide mayor, and the incumbent is Daniella Levine Cava. The office is technically non-partisan, but Levine Cava is a Democrat. She will run for a second term against six other candidates, the most prominent of which seems to be Manny Cid, the mayor of the town of Miami Lakes.

Republicans controlled the mayoral seat in Miami-Dade County for 16 years before Levine Cava’s election in 2020. There will be a runoff in November if no candidate receives a simple majority.

As for Tulsa, the seat is open as incumbent Republican GT Bynum is not running for a third term. Seven candidates are in the race to replace him. Oklahoma is a very red state, but Tulsa is far less so than the state’s average. However, they have not had a Democratic mayor since 2009. Like Miami’s election, this is also runoff-eligible if no candidate passes the threshold.

August State Primaries

Multiple states will hold their statewide primaries in August:

  • Tennessee (August 1)
  • Kansas (August 6)
  • Michigan (August 6)
  • Missouri (August 6)
  • Washington (August 6)
  • Hawaii (August 10)
  • Connecticut (August 13)
  • Minnesota (August 13)
  • Vermont (August 13)
  • Wisconsin (August 13)
  • Alaska (August 20)
  • Florida (August 20)
  • Wyoming (August 20)

Other Elections: International

Kiribati: The only scheduled national election in August 2024 is the parliamentary election in Kiribati. Its two rounds will take place on the 14th and 19th, respectively. This Pacific island nation of over just over 100,000 will elect 44 new MPs. There is a 45th member, an unelected delegate.

Northern Territory (Australia): We get to cover our first Australian election in August, as the Top End and other nearby areas head to the polls on 24 August. The centre-left Labor Party has ruled since 2016, but they will have difficulty winning a third term. Labor leader Eva Lawler has only been in the top job since December, but if opinion polls are right, Lia Finocchiaro of the centre-right Country Liberals may soon be the new chief minister.
